\/><\/a><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">In 2011 Alma de Colores was created as one of the Centro Maya programs encouraging inclusive employment and socializing for people with disabilities in San Juan La Laguna and municipalities around Lake Atitl\u00e1n.\u00a0 The initiative originated out of the need to create employment opportunities which offered training and respectable jobs as well as providing services and generating development for the community.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">Currently, the program directly benefits twenty-five individuals and indirectly assists 100 users who receive therapy at the Center.\u00a0 Alma de Colores is made up of five production and educational areas:\u00a0 artisan crafts which encourage use of local seeds and weavings, sewing, utilizing recycled fabrics to produce innovative products which are useful personal items, such as coin purses, shopping bags, aprons, etc.\u00a0 And there is a cafe-lunch counter which promotes eating locally by offering vegetarian entrees, contributing to a healthy diet.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">In addition, there is a bakery which produces whole grain bread from dough using minimally processed ingredients.\u00a0 And there are organic gardens where vegetables are produced that are served in the cafe and restaurant.\u00a0 These generate a concern for the environment, take advantage of the natural cycles inherent in polyculture farming which protects the lake and the soil, avoiding the introduction of pollutants.\u00a0 This part of Alma de Colores also serves as a demonstration tool for other organizations, schools and people, particularly those interested in learning about environmental sustainability theory and practice.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_4481\"
